Tarmacadam Road Surfacing : Techniques and Best Guidelines
The laying of tarmacadam road surfacing requires detailed planning and adherence to recommended techniques . Usually , the work begins with proper site preparation , including the removal of existing material and the compaction of the sub-base. Base course foundations are then laid and consolidated to ensure a firm foundation. The tarmacadam compound itself – a blend of aggregate and bitumen – is heated to the correct heat before being poured and smoothed in consistent sections. Quality control assessments throughout the undertaking are crucial to guarantee a durable and secure road covering. Best practices also stress proper drainage and the use of appropriate machinery for effective execution and longevity of the road.

Green Road Surfacing Choices
The growing pressure for environmentally-sound construction practices is prompting innovation in road building . Traditional tarmacadam, while long-lasting, commonly relies on energy-heavy processes . Thankfully, multiple innovative solutions are appearing that substantially minimize the carbon effect. These include :
- Reclaimed Asphalt Pavement : Utilizing waste asphalt from removed roads.
- Porous Pavement: Allowing rainfall to seep through, lessening flood and recharging groundwater.
- Plant-derived Binders: Replacing petroleum-based bitumen with substances from sustainable supplies.
- Low-carbon Concrete Mixes : Incorporating waste elements to decrease cement content, a substantial factor to carbon
Embracing these green road solutions is essential for constructing a truly sustainable future for infrastructure.
